*Tabby: The tabby cat has a distinctive coat that features stripes, dots, or swirling patterns. Tabbies are sometimes erroneously assumed to be a breed of cat. In fact, the tabby pattern is a naturally occurring feature that may be related to the coloration of the domestic cat's distant ancestor, the African Wildcat. Tabby color is found in many breeds of cat, as well as among the general mixed-breed population. The tabby usually has an "M" mark on its forehead

*Siamese: Siamese are a very intelligent, lively, entertaining cat. They can be very demanding and become totally involved in their owner's life. Siamese do not like to be ignored and always have to be the centre of attention. They usually regard themselves as people rather than cats. You will never be bored if you own a Siamese cat.

Siamese have a strong personality and are usually very talkative, often with a loud voice. The Siamese voice is quite legendary and they use it well to communicate with humans. Their meow has been compared to the cries of a human baby. They enjoy being with people and have a great need for human companionship. Siamese cats are sometimes described as extroverts. Often they bond strongly to a single person.
